Admission requirements for studying in the field of digitalization
You can complete the Bachelor’s degree in Business Informatics as a first degree course while working. Previous knowledge in the fields of economics, computer science or management as well as practical experience in planning and/or implementing digital strategies in a company will make it easier for you to get started, but are by no means essential for a successful application.
Have you already decided to study for a Bachelor’s degree in Business Informatics, but are still looking for an employer for the practical part of the Project Competence Study Program®? On the SCMT job board you will find job offers from companies from a wide range of industries where you can implement projects related to digitization and transformation during your studies. – Continue to the SCMT job portal.
- Application for the Project Competence Study Program® via www.eis-scmt.com
- University entrance qualification (Abitur, Fachhochschulreife) or secondary school leaving certificate, completed vocational training and at least three years of professional experience or master craftsman (HK/IHK) or state-recognized technician or business economist
- Very good knowledge of German and English
- Successfully completed application process
- Challenging project in a partner company (cooperation with one of our partners or with your current employer)
Core content of the digitization course
The Bachelor’s degree in Business Information Systems combines the basics of computer science with the central concepts of business administration and economics. At the same time, you will also lay the foundations for your development as a manager of the future. To this end, you will also familiarize yourself with the legal aspects of digitalization in companies and learn how to conduct effective project, personnel and financial management during your studies.
Methods and scientific work
Writing scientific papers – Criteria and instruments – Empirical research concepts
Projectmanagement
Methods and tools – Phases of project management – Agile project management
Economic mathematics and statistics
Variables, differences and equations – Data analysis – Statistical distributions
Programming
Introduction to the basics – Object-oriented programming – JavaScript
IT service processes
IT Service Management – IT Service Strategy – IT Service Improvement
Database systems
Structure of database systems – Relational database systems – Rights management
Business and economics teaching
Corporate goals and management – Operational financial processes – Economic principles
Corporate management
Mission, vision and long-term goals – Strategy definition – Balanced scorecards
Digital infrastructures
Software architectures and infrastructures – Distributed systems – Service-oriented architectures (SOA)
Specializations and certifications in the Digitalization and Transformation degree program
The specialization modules in the Bachelor of Business Informatics prepare you to analyse, manage and optimize different fields of application of digital technologies in companies. The focus areas are chosen so that you can discover and further develop your individual skills profile as a specialist. On the one hand, you can focus on technical issues and the development of new solutions with automation and cloud computing. On the other hand, you can also focus intensively on the opportunities and challenges that digitalization holds for innovation management and customer management.
IT controlling
Controlling basics – Key figures – IT controlling processes
E-Business
Online retail – Supply chain management – Procurement
Digital transformation
Digitalization and automation – Innovation management – Cloud computing – Customer relationship management
In cooperation with Salesforce, we also offer you the opportunity to acquire additional qualifications in the field of digitalization during the course of your studies. You can choose from the following official Salesforce certifications:
Admin Essentials (ADX201)
App Builder (DEV402)
Sales Cloud (ADM251)
Service Cloud (ADM261)
Marketing Cloud (EEB101)
Advanced Admin (ADX211)
